Building with Modern Web Coding Tools 2025: A Practical Guide
Ready to put these tools into action? Here’s a simplified guide to building a modern web app. I'll focus on the tools I use every day. This approach helps you create scalable fullstack apps.
- Start with a Solid Frontend Framework: Pick React or Next. js. They are powerful and broadly supported. Next. js offers server-side rendering (SSR) and static site generation (SSG). This is fantastic for speed and SEO.
- Example: When I built PostFaster, I chose Next. js. It gave me the flexibility needed for a complex content management system. You can learn more about web coding basics on Wikipedia.
- Add TypeScript for Type Safety: Always use TypeScript with your frontend. It catches errors before you even run your code. This saves a lot of debugging time. It's a big improvement for large projects.
- Tip: You can find official docs and guides at typescriptlang. org.
- Style with Tailwind CSS: Forget writing custom CSS from scratch. Tailwind CSS gives you utility classes to build beautiful designs fast. It keeps your styling consistent.
- Manage State Well: For client-side state, try Zustand or Redux. Zustand is lightweight and simple. Redux offers powerful tools for complex global state. Choose what fits your project's needs.
- Build a Strong Backend: Node. js is my go-to for backend services. Pair it with a framework like Express or NestJS. NestJS offers a structured, modular approach. It's great for enterprise-level apps.
- Choose a Reliable Database: PostgreSQL is a fantastic relational database. MongoDB is great for flexible, NoSQL needs. For real-time features and login, Supabase is an excellent choice. It combines PostgreSQL with powerful backend services.
- Implement CI/CD: Set up a continuous connection and continuous launch pipeline. Tools like Azure DevOps or Jenkins automate testing and launchs. This make sures your code is always ready to go live. For instance, I use Azure DevOps to make sure my projects are deployed smoothly, which drastically reduces manual errors by 50%.
- Containerize with Docker: Docker packages your app and its packages. This make sures it runs the same way everywhere. It simplifies launch across different setups.
Tips for Using Modern Web Coding Tools 2025 Well
Just having the tools isn't enough. You need to use them well. Here are some tips I've picked up over the years. These will help you get the most out of Modern web coding tools 2025.
- Focus on Core Concepts: Understand why a tool exists, not just how to use it. Learn JavaScript basics before diving deep into React. A strong foundation makes learning new tools easier.
- Automate Everything Possible: Use linters, formatters, and automated tests. Jest and Cypress are excellent for testing. Automation catches bugs early. It also frees up your time for more complex tasks.
- Prioritize Speed: Always think about speed. Improve images, lazy-load parts, and use efficient data fetching. Small improvements add up to a much better user time.
- Stay Curious, But Don't Over-Improve: The tech landscape changes fast. Keep an eye on new Modern web coding tools 2025. But don't switch stacks just because something new appears. Evaluate if it genuinely solves a problem for your project.
- Learn from Others: Participate in dev communities. Read blogs, watch tutorials, and attend conferences. Sharing knowledge is a powerful way to grow. Many timed engineers share insights on platforms like dev. to.
